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Thetford to Peterborough start from as little as £5.90

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Thetford to Peterborough are available for £25.30 one way, or £39.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Thetford train station is equipped to cater to your ticket purchasing needs with its ticket office open every weekday and Saturday from 07:00 to 13:30. Even if the office is closed, ticket machines are available, and they are accessible to assist all travellers, providing the convenience to collect tickets purchased online. The presence of an induction loop ensures that those with hearing impairments can stay informed.

While the station currently lacks on-site dining and shopping options, this shortfall is compensated by its focus on accessibility. Step-free access to Platform 2 is available for journeys towards Ely and Cambridge, while a footpath from Croxton Road ensures access to Platform 1 for services heading to Norwich. The station's bicycle facilities include both sheltered standings and CCTV for added security.

Accessible Travel and Support

Accessibility is a priority at Thetford Station. It is equipped with ramps for train access, on-hand wheelchairs, and dedicated customer help points. Although accessible toilets are not available, the station strives to support passengers with mobility needs. It’s categorized as a B2 station by the Office of Rail and Road, highlighting its partial accessibility and proactive assistance approaches.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Peterborough train station is well-equipped to handle the needs of today's travelers. The ticket office is open daily from 6:00 AM to 8:00 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 8:00 AM to 8:00 PM on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ting tickets, including accessible machines for everyone to use. The station is committed to accessibility with features like step-free access to all seven platforms, accessible toilets and seating, and staff assistance available throughout operational hours. The station also boasts heated waiting rooms, an induction loop, and a RNIB Map for All to aid visually impaired passengers.

Passengers can enjoy a variety of refreshment options with numerous coffee shops and cafés. For a touch of convenience, ATMs and shops are located within the station vicinity. Although public Wi-Fi isn't available, you can easily access payphones if needed.

Onward Travel and Transport Links

Peterborough station is not just about trains. There are ample onward travel options, making it easy to reach your final destination. Taxis are readily available at the station entrance, with a private hire firm on-site for added convenience. Those seeking eco-friendly travel have access to Brompton Dock bicycle hire. Local bus services complement rail services, providing passengers flexible connectivity options. For rail disruptions, replacement services depart directly from the main entrance, ensuring minimal inconvenience.
